Innovate for Impact Challenge 2026

Administered by World Food Prize Foundation

18 days remaining
agtechagriculturesustainabilityglobal challengestartup competitionfood security

About this grant

The Innovate for Impact Challenge is a global initiative hosted by the World Food Prize Foundation in collaboration with America's Cultivation Corridor. The program is designed to accelerate early-stage, technology-driven AgTech startups that address critical challenges related to global food security and sustainability. Unveiled at the 2024 Norman E. Borlaug International Dialogue , the Challenge invites entrepreneurs from around the world to showcase breakthrough agricultural technologies with the potential to transform food systems. Key Highlights Global call for early-stage AgTech startups Strong emphasis on innovation, sustainability, and scalability Live pitch competition at the 2026 Borlaug Dialogue in Des Moines, Iowa Top prize of $50,000 USD for the winning startup Significant global exposure to investors, policymakers, and agricultural leaders

Eligibility requirements

All of the following criteria must be met:

  • Must be an
  • early-stage, for-profit startup
  • operating in the AgTech space
  • Stage of development can range from
  • validated concept to pre-Series A
  • At least
  • one founder must be working full-time
  • on the startup
  • Must demonstrate:
  • Strong innovation and technological differentiation
  • Clear market potential within the agricultural sector
  • Alignment with environmental and social sustainability goals
  • Applications are evaluated based on:
  • Innovation impact and novelty
  • Market viability and demand
  • Sustainability contribution
  • Scalability and replicability across regions and contexts
  • Application Process
  • Create an account on the application portal and start a new application.
  • Complete the full online application form with all required information.
  • Submit the application before the deadline.
  • Selection Timeline
  • Applications Open:
  • January 21, 2026
  • Submission Deadline:
  • April 15, 2026
  • Top 10 Announced:
  • July 16, 2026
  • Selected startups submit pitch videos and financial details
  • Virtual Public Voting:
  • July 16–25, 2026
  • Top 3 Announced:
  • August 5, 2026
  • Finalists must travel to Des Moines, Iowa
  • Final Live Pitch:
  • October 20–22, 2026 at the Borlaug Dialogue
  • Judges review written submissions and live pitches to determine 1st, 2nd, and 3rd place winners.
